In a world often divided by borders and politics, the inspiring achievements of Neeraj Chopra from India and Arshad Nadeem from Pakistan at the Paris 2024 Olympics remind us of the power of unity, love, and the human spirit. Both athletes, hailing from the culturally rich region of Punjab, won medals in the men’s javelin throw—Arshad took gold, while Neeraj secured silver. However, beyond the medals, it’s the heartwarming reactions of their mothers that have touched the world, symbolizing a bond that transcends the political divide between India and Pakistan.

Two Mothers, One Heart: Love Beyond Borders

The story gained momentum when Neeraj's mother, Saroj Devi, expressed her happiness not only for her son’s silver medal but also for Arshad’s gold, saying that Arshad is like a son to her. In a beautiful response, Arshad’s mother echoed the sentiment, declaring that Neeraj is also her son. This mutual respect and affection between the two mothers resonated deeply across both nations, offering a rare moment of unity in a region often marked by tension.

Arshad Nadeem: A Journey of Grit and Determination

Arshad Nadeem’s path to Olympic glory is nothing short of extraordinary. Coming from the small town of Mian Channu in Pakistan’s Punjab province, Arshad faced significant challenges, including financial struggles and outdated training equipment. Yet, his village rallied behind him, raising funds for his training and travel expenses—a testament to the communal spirit in rural Pakistan.

Despite these obstacles, Arshad’s determination never wavered. His hard work culminated in a historic throw of 92.97 meters in Paris, breaking the Olympic record and earning Pakistan’s first Olympic gold medal in 32 years. Neeraj Chopra: A Champion’s Spirit

Neeraj Chopra has already established himself as one of India’s greatest athletes, with a gold medal from the Tokyo 2020 Olympics and now a silver from Paris. His performance in Paris was remarkable, with a best throw of 89.45 meters. Although he narrowly missed the gold, Neeraj’s achievement solidifies his status as a world-class javelin thrower and a national hero in India.

What makes this event truly special is the mutual respect and camaraderie between Neeraj and Arshad. Both athletes have consistently supported and encouraged each other, embodying the true spirit of sportsmanship.
